Police hunt ‘random’ gunman in Upper Darby

- By Kevin Tustin ktustin@21st-centurymed­ia.com

UPPER DARBY >> Police are investigat­ing a random shooting early Sunday morning that left a man in stable condition.

Upper Darby Police Superinten­dent Michael Chitwood said Tuesday that an unknown black male shot a 35-year-old man at point blank range in an alley behind 7026 Terminal Square at approximat­ely 2 a.m. Sunday. Only one shot was fired at the victim, the bullet going through his arm and exiting his body through the back.

“It looks like just a random shooting, but the guy (suspect) looks like he’s just waiting out,” said Chitwood about the shooting.

According to Chitwood, the victim and his girlfriend had left the Sabor Latino bar on Garrett Road and returned to their car in the alley behind the Terminal Square shopping complex. On the way to their car the couple had seen the shooter, described as a tall black male wearing all black and a black backpack, in the alley and walked past him without incident.

In surveillan­ce footage released by police Tuesday morning the woman is seen in the passenger seat with the car door open and the victim standing over his girlfriend. Chitwood said they were looking for something in the car at that time.

Behind their car is a white SUV and the shooter is seen coming out from behind it and approaches the couple at their car. The shooter pulls out a gun and walks closer to the male and shoots him once before fleeing across the nearby SEPTA trolley tracks. The victim was taken to Lankenau Medical Center.

In interviewi­ng the couple Chitwood said there was no confrontat­ion at the bar with any of the patrons and that their testimonie­s were consistent.

Police are trying to figure out the “why” of the crime.

“We don’t have any cause for the shooting other than it appears to be a random shooting,” said Chitwood. “This is concerning. We’re trying to get the perpetrato­r, the ‘baddie,’ off the streets.”

Chitwood said it could have been a hit or have been the action of someone with mental illness.

The suspect will answer to criminal attempt homicide charges when captured.
